    Formwork panels create a temporary mold into which wet concrete is poured and contained as it hardens. Panels are typically made of wood, steel, aluminum, or fiberglass. They interlock in a grid-like configuration using ties and braces to build the overall concrete form. Panels must withstand concrete pressure while maintaining dimensional accuracy for the cured structure.

    Increasingly, constructors are adopting system formwork over traditional site-built wooden forms. System formwork relies on prefabricated modular panels that are erected on-site. These systems boost productivity and enable faster, safer construction of complex structures. As urbanization and massive projects like high-rises, bridges, dams, and stadiums increase globally, system formwork adoption fuels formwork panel market growth.

    The glass wafer begins as a cylindrical boule made from materials like quartz, borosilicate glass, or aluminosilicate glass. These glass formulations possess high uniformity and chemical stability needed for fabricating electronic components. The boule is sliced into thin discs using specialized saws, then polished down to an optically flat and scratch-free surface. These glass wafers serve as the foundational substrate onto which the active layers of a semiconductor device are deposited.

    Before device fabrication, glass wafers undergo extremely thorough cleaning and surface preparation. Steps like solvent cleaning, wet chemical etching, and high temperature annealing remove contaminants and enhance the molecular bonding between the glass and deposited films. The purity and integrity of the glass wafer surface is paramount for enabling proper electrical performance and reliability.

    Based on end-use industry, the Automotive & Transportation sector is predicted to have the largest technical foam market share during the forecast period. To improve fuel efficiency, the automobile industry prioritizes reducing total vehicle weight. Improving fuel efficiency while adhering to environmental regulations is projected to help this category grow during the projection period. Aside from energy savings, the use of foam components improves passenger comfort by reducing ambient noise. These materials offer excellent energy absorption, dampening, and acoustic insulation, allowing passengers to ride in peace and comfort. Flexible foam for vehicle seats with great durability and long-term comfort is becoming increasingly popular among foam producers and car seat manufacturers.
